Common mistakes we fix
One "ducted heating replacement" page targeting every service variant
Split by service type and intent so Google can match urgent, comparison and commercial queries to the right URL.
Chasing free or coupon keywords without qualifying intent
Pair offers with service context and area limits so SEO brings booked jobs, not rebate-only, DIY, job-seeker and out-of-area clicks.
Mixing high-ticket and general services on one landing page
Different proof, pricing and sales cycles need separate pillars.
Duplicate suburb pages with swapped city names
Each area page needs unique proof, service notes and internal links.
Ranking without conversion elements for urgent searches
Availability, guarantee badges and short booking paths reduce drop-off.
Inconsistent NAP across GBP, website and directories
Audit and fix name, address and phone formatting everywhere.
Optimizing the website but ignoring GBP and map pack
Treat GBP services, photos, posts and reviews as part of SEO.
